According to relationship experts and legal analysts, narcissists often leverage certain legal maneuvers to perpetuate control following divorce proceedings. These include exploiting legal processes, manipulating custody arrangements, and using financial leverage to exert influence. While specific cases are not publicly documented in detail, the trend signals a growing concern among mental health professionals and legal practitioners about how narcissistic individuals use the law as a tool for continued dominance. This pattern appears to be part of broader manipulative behaviors that extend beyond emotional abuse into the legal realm, complicating efforts for victims to establish independence and stability.

Research into these tactics suggests they often involve exploiting ambiguities in custody and visitation laws, filing frivolous motions, or leveraging financial assets to pressure the ex-partner. Experts emphasize that understanding these tactics can help victims recognize and counteract them, and that legal professionals should be alert to such manipulative strategies during divorce proceedings. Why Recognizing Legal Narcissist Tactics Matters

Understanding these five tactics is vital because they can significantly impact a victim’s legal rights, emotional well-being, and financial stability after divorce. Narcissists’ manipulation of legal processes can delay or obstruct fair custody and property settlements, prolonging conflict and stress for the victim. Recognizing these behaviors allows victims to seek appropriate legal advice, potentially prevent exploitation, and protect their autonomy during a vulnerable time. This awareness also highlights the need for legal reforms and training to identify and counteract manipulative tactics in family law cases.

Legal and Support Strategies for Victims

Legal professionals and mental health advocates are calling for increased awareness and training to identify manipulative tactics in divorce cases. Victims are encouraged to seek specialized legal advice, document all interactions, and consider protective orders if necessary. Future developments may include legal reforms aimed at closing loopholes exploited by narcissists and improving victim protections. Ongoing research and advocacy efforts are expected to shed more light on the scope of this issue and effective countermeasures.

How can victims protect themselves from these tactics?

Victims should seek experienced legal counsel, document all interactions, and consider protective orders or legal safeguards to prevent manipulation and harassment.

Are these tactics considered illegal?

While some behaviors may be legally permissible, others may border on legal abuse or harassment. Legal professionals can help determine appropriate responses and remedies.

Is there ongoing research on this trend?

Research is limited, but awareness is growing among mental health and legal communities. More systematic studies are needed to understand the scope and develop effective interventions.
